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

C# mysql i naravno nasa slova

[es] :: .NET :: .NET Desktop razvoj :: C# mysql i naravno nasa slova

[ Pregleda: 5398 | Odgovora: 7 ] > FB > Twit

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

sstanko78
Novi Sad

Član broj: 19139
Poruke: 411
195.252.85.*



Profil

icon C# mysql i naravno nasa slova21.04.2005. u 09:28 - pre 231 meseci
Koristio sam .net connector (poslednja verzija) ali u aplikacijama koje sam
pisao nikako nisam mogao da dobijem nasa slova (char set. za mysql server je podešen na win1250). Za divno čudo mysql query browser prilikom testiranja SELECT upita odlično radi sa našim slovima. Ne mogu da otkrijem problem. A da probao sam i ODBC, ali i on se isto tako ponaša. Umesto naših slova u mojim win formama se pojavljuju bezvezni znakovi.
Help !!!!!!!!!!!!!!!
 
Odgovor na temu

sstanko78
Novi Sad

Član broj: 19139
Poruke: 411
195.252.85.*



Profil

icon Re: C# mysql i naravno nasa slova23.04.2005. u 16:56 - pre 231 meseci
char set sam prebacio na croat i dobio sam naša slova, tj. bar neka Š,Ž,Đ. Ali Č i Ć se ne razlikuju, tj. dobijam samo C. Tako da je problem delimično rešen. Sada koristim ODBC. Da ponovim, problem je vezan sa WinForms aplikacijama u C#
 
Odgovor na temu

hacker86
Srđan Jovanović
Programer

Član broj: 46144
Poruke: 35
*.ptt.yu.

Sajt: www.pima-alarms.co.rs


Profil

icon Re: C# mysql i naravno nasa slova24.04.2005. u 01:36 - pre 231 meseci
Kao što sam ti predhodno napisao latin2_croatian_ci... meni je upalilo za Delphi 2005 #C .NET konektor, ali sam imao velike probleme u Kylix-u, pa sam na kraju sam napisao kompletan klijent...
Najveći problem je sam kompajler za .NET, odnosno MySQL je primarno rešenje za Linux, a oni vode našu latinicu po standardu ISO 8859-2 Central European, za razliku od Win1250.
Možeš da probaš i setovanja Latin2 - latin2_general_ci.

Preporuka:
Ukoliko tvoja aplikacije ne zahteva više od 20-ak korisnika istovremeno preporučujem ti MSDE2000A (MS SQL Server - besplatna varijanta). Sve što odradiš sa WinForms prima UNICODE bez problema, nema čestih Access Violation kao sa ODBC drajverima i MySQL.

Iz mog, ličnog, iskustva treba uvek zaobići ODBC + MySQL, jer ne postoji bagovitija i problematičnija stvar na ovom svetu, gori je i od Access indexa zajedno sa MS Windows porodicom :))
hacker
 
Odgovor na temu

kristian!

Član broj: 8348
Poruke: 150
*.zrlocal.net.

Sajt: www.linkoovi.net


+1 Profil

icon Re: C# mysql i naravno nasa slova11.01.2006. u 18:06 - pre 222 meseci
Pozdrav,

Ja radim WinAplikaciju sa Access "bazom", I imam isti problem sa č i ć,
button č i button ć pretrazuju access za prvo slovo u stringu. Problem je sto se čć pretvore u c, u access "bazi" je sve ok. Kako da se ova dva karaktera ne izgube u applikaciji?
 
Odgovor na temu

ALGHEN
Beograd / Zlatibor

Član broj: 65866
Poruke: 33
*.vdial.verat.net.

Sajt: www.ghc.rs


Profil

icon Re: C# mysql i naravno nasa slova27.03.2006. u 10:58 - pre 219 meseci
Vidim da je malko zastarela tema :), ali imam slicnih muka sa nasim slovima i MySQL bazom, samo je to kod mene malo zamrsenije.
Citat:
char set sam prebacio na croat i dobio sam naša slova, tj. bar neka Š,Ž,Đ. Ali Č i Ć se ne razlikuju, tj. dobijam samo C. Tako da je problem delimično rešen. Sada koristim ODBC. Da ponovim, problem je vezan sa WinForms aplikacijama u C#

Elem, problem sa MySQL bazom i WinForms smo resili posle par dana lupanja glave gde bi bio problem sa REGIONALNIM POSTAVKAMA SISTEMA.

Control panel / Regional and language options / Advanced / pa na opciji "Select a language to match the language version of the non-Unicode programs you want to use" postaviti na "Serbian(latin)", i, gle cuda, eto ih sva srpska slova (ČĆĐŠŽ) u Win Formama, a mi se ubili razmisljajuci o cemu se radi :).

P.S.: I ova aplikacija je napisana sa ODBC (kasno smo skontali Connector :) ), nije on taj koji nam je pravio probleme.

Eto, pa ako nekome pomogne, dobro jeste...

Pozdrav...
 
Odgovor na temu

Prokleta_Nedelja
Beograd

Član broj: 90608
Poruke: 450
*.teol.net.



+42 Profil

icon Re: C# mysql i naravno nasa slova28.01.2007. u 08:00 - pre 209 meseci
I ja imam isti problem sa MySQL i ASP, kad koristim connector, nemam problema samo ne znam da napravim sa konektorom fazone kao sa odbc-om (tipa pagnation i tako dalje)

moze li jedan primjer kako connector u potpunosti zamjenjuje odbc?
 
Odgovor na temu

Prokleta_Nedelja
Beograd

Član broj: 90608
Poruke: 450
*.teol.net.



+42 Profil

icon Re: C# mysql i naravno nasa slova28.01.2007. u 11:12 - pre 209 meseci
Skontao sam kako da ASP prikaze lijepo nasa slova, u connection stringu koji koristi ODBC stavite:
"DRIVER={MySQL ODBC 3.51 Driver};SERVER=localhost;DATABASE=baza;UID=root;PWD=aaa;OPTION=3;stmt=SET NAMES 'cp1250'"

ovo stmt=SET NAMES 'cp1250' je bilo ono sto mi je nedostajalo da lijepo prikazem slova. Mozda nekome pomogne
 
Odgovor na temu

sstanko78
Novi Sad

Član broj: 19139
Poruke: 411
195.252.85.*



Profil

icon Re: C# mysql i naravno nasa slova28.01.2007. u 21:22 - pre 209 meseci
U međuvremenu smo presli na SQL Server 2005 Express
Ali problem je ostao imam jos uveka bazu sa "zarobljenim" podacima. Probacu
 
Odgovor na temu

[es] :: .NET :: .NET Desktop razvoj :: C# mysql i naravno nasa slova

[ Pregleda: 5398 | Odgovora: 7 ] > FB > Twit

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.